About Emma Neeson
When not messing around with Risk of Rain 2 mods, Emma can be found absorbed in their latest creative pursuit. Passionate about writing and video games, with an English degree to boot, Emma is always looking for the next great story to get lost in. As well as working for The Best War Games as a Contributor, they pursue their own projects, whether that's creative writing or something crafty.
Gaming has been a part of their life ever since Jak and Daxter on the PS2. They’ve spent a long time creating many well-regarded maps for a Dawn of War II mod and organizing tournaments for a couple of RTS communities. In recent years, they’ve explored every nook and cranny of the Soulsborne series and thought more about how people form attachments with the virtual spaces we inhabit. Emma is also waiting for a new Deus Ex game, and they’ve been waiting a while...
